Boys’ Basketball The high school basketball squad was coached by Mr. Merle Darcangelo this year. Hayden Rentfrow, Clifford Ristine, Billy Kjersem, and Jackson Stellingwerf were all new members of the squad. Billy Kjersem and Jackson Stellingwerf did not complete the year with the team as they left school in January0 The team improved rapidly from the start. It lost most of the games played, but was able to threaten the other teams considerably. The boys also showed very good sportsmanship even though they sometimes lost by only five or six points0 Most of the players will return next year and Mr. Darcangelo also hopes to be back. The boys who earned recognition this year were: Harold Dover, Captain and center; Phillip Lilley, Co-captain; Bennie Petersen, left forward; George Crabtree, right forward; Hayden P entfrow, right guard; Sonny Ristine, left guard; Benton Dover, and John Flugge. The grade basketball team was coached by Mr. Darcangelo and the squad con- sisted of: Robert Crabtree, Captain; Hilliard McDonald, Roger Petersen, Dannis Woodard, Daniel Crabtree, Arthur Dover, Floyd Biehl, and Lloyd Crabtree0 They played several games this year and put up a good scrap at all times, but due to their lack of height, they were unable to cope with their opponents. We all hope that next year they will have some height to enable them to do better. With all these difficulties to overcome, they were still the best of sportsc Their teamwork, plus ability, give promise of better teams in the future. Girls’ Physical Training At the beginning of the year, the girls played baseball with the boys0 When the boys started basketball practice, the girls began to play volleyballo On the days when there were basketball games, the boys would play volleyball with the girls. But, being there were more boys, they would beat the girls. There are nine girls in high school: Mary Piane, LaVonne Gardner, Joan Fairbanks, Jean Nevin, Ella Dover, Gertrude McDonald, Susie Nall, Christine Fairbanks, and Mary Alice Dover. The seventh and eighth grade girls include: Connie Scritchfield, Lois Jean Flugge, Anita June Dover, Genevieve McDonald and Maralyn Dover. We played a volleyball game with Judith Gap. Pep Club The cheerleaders chosen were: LaVonne Gardner, Ella Dover, and Jean Nevin for the high school; Connie Scritchfield, Maralyn Dover, and Genevieve McDonald for the grades. At first our cheerleaders had to practice very hard to learn to co- ordinate the yells with their motions0 When this was accomplished, the Pep Club members enjoyed learning new yells. All of us feel that we could not get along without our cheering section at the games. 24
